What Are “Bold Counterparts”—And Why Do They Matter?
Bold counterparts are not just synonyms—they’re intentionally powerful alternate terms or phrases that carry similar strategic weight but diverge in tone, intensity, or connotation. For example:
- “Exclusive” vs. “Limited Edition”: Both signal scarcity, but “exclusive” feels more personal and premium, while “limited edition” appeals to urgency.
- “Transform” vs. “Elevate”: Both convey improvement, yet “transform” implies radical change; “elevate” suggests steady growth.
- “Decisive” vs. “Confident”: “Decisive” shows action and outcome, while “confident” speaks to internal state—different but complementary.
These bold counterparts enhance semantic diversity without straying from your core keyword’s meaning, allowing you to cover topics more comprehensively.

How to Discover and Use Bold Counterparts Effectively
-
Audit Your Top Keywords
Start with your primary keyword list. Pick terms with high search volume and relevance. -
Identify Semantic Fields
Use tools like Thesaurus.com, SEMrush, or Ahrefs to explore semantic variations. Look at related words with contrasting nuances. -
Analyze Audience Language
Observe how different segments talk about your topic. A product title’s “top performer” might face “best-selling icon” in reviews—both valid bold counterparts. -
Match Tone and Context
Ensure alternatives fit your brand voice—formal, casual, technical, emotional. Boldness doesn’t mean randomness; context matters. -
Test for SEO Impact
Use keyword planner tools to check ranking potential and readability. Avoid overstuffing—balance is key.
